Confirmed Exoplanet Discovered 2015

Kepler-431 b

A rocky terrestrial orbiting the f-type yellow-white Kepler-431, located approximately 1,586.9 light-years from Earth.

Key parameters at a glance

  • A radius of 0.76 Earth radii
  • A mass of 0.37 Earth masses
  • Surface gravity around 0.63 g
  • An orbital period of 6.803 days
  • Semi-major axis 0.0719 AU
  • Equilibrium temperature 1,032 K (759 °C)
  • Distance from Earth 1,586.90 light-years
  • Earth Similarity Index 0.290
  • Travel time at Voyager 1 speed 27,984,962 years

2 siblings around Kepler-431

Kepler-431 b shares its host star with 2 other confirmed planets. Side-by-side measurements below.

Planet Type Radius (R⊕) Mass (M⊕) Period (d) Eq. T (K) Year
Kepler-431 b this Rocky Terrestrial 0.76 0.37 6.803 1,032 2015
Kepler-431 c Rocky Terrestrial 0.67 0.23 8.703 951 2015
Kepler-431 d Rocky Terrestrial 1.11 1.41 11.922 856 2015
